Output c84f297012574aa4aa4d56504cc872bde6a5c89f923293977c16b513372c2d71:12

value
9160139
script pubkey
OP_0 OP_PUSHBYTES_20 32b0c262f043e739d39c5d41d18988389a00e3eb
address
bc1qx2cvychsg0nnn5uut4qarzvg8zdqpcltnq26s2
transaction
c84f297012574aa4aa4d56504cc872bde6a5c89f923293977c16b513372c2d71
confirmations
393219
spent
true